본문 바로가기
[Javascript] 이벤트 등록하는 방법 3가지 1. 인라인 방식(inline) 이벤트를 html 요소의 속성으로 직접 지정하는 방식 html 코드와 스크립트가 섞여 사용, html 코드와 스크립트 코드는 분리가 유지보수에 용이하다고 하지만.. 우리 회사 같은 경우에는 굉~~ 장히 많이 사용되고 있는 방식 중 하나라 알아두면 요긴하게 쓰인다. Test 2. 프로퍼티 방식(Property) 이벤트를 자바스크립트 코드에서 프로퍼티로 등록하여 사용하는 방식 html 코드와 자바스크립트가 섞여 사용되지 않음 하나의 이벤트 핸들러 프로퍼티엔 하나의 이벤트핸들러만 바인딩 가능 let testBtn = document.querySelector('#testBtn'); testBtn.onclick = function () { alert('Hello world1'); .. 2022. 1. 9.
[jQuery][Javascript] Getting attribute of a parent node $(this).parentNode.attr('class') Getting attribute of a parent node $(this).parentNode.attr('class') jquery와 plain javascript를 섞어 섰다는것.. java 사용해서 백엔드단만 작업하다보니 전혀 생각못했던 부분이었다.. jquery를 사용하는곳이 아직 많기 때문에 해당부분을 유의해서 코드작업을 해야할것 같다. // jQuery $(this).parent().attr('class'); // Vanila Javascript this.parentNode.getAttribute("class"); attr() 메서드와 getAttribute()메서드 .attr() 메서드 .attr(attributeName) .attr(attributeName,value) 선택한요소의 속성의 .. 2022. 1. 1.